The home library service is available for people of all ages who are unable to access our services either on a temporary or permanent basis.
Anyone can use our services who is unable to reach a static or mobile library. Many of our clients are elderly and or disabled. This service includes but is not limited to Carers and Cared for people. We deliver books and audio books.

Offer information, friendship and support to local people with Parkinson's, their families and carers. Also organise regular events and social activities - join and meet other people affected by Parkinson's in your area.
People with Parkinson's, their families and carers.
